he needed a good outing on Saturday evening in the worst of ways and for a while he was having a good outing the shame of this 5-1 loss at the Phillies beyond the NS bad offensive performance is that what was looking like a very encouraging start for McKenzie Gore ended up unraveling Gore ultimately was not good for a ninth time in 10 starts his final line five runs in five and 2/3 Innings but he allowed one run in five innings then came a 4-run six for the Phillies Gore in that inning was charged with all four of the runs he in the inning gave up five hits recorded just two outs two of the hits were singles that each had an exit velocity of at least 101 mph per stat cat so you can't necessarily say that Gore you know got babed in that inning or something like that he gave up some hard contact he gave up a bunch of hits gor for the game gave up nine hits which were two doubles and seven singles he issued two walks he did record six strikeouts so he was back to generating some strikeouts he threw 92 pitches 58 strikes versus 34 balls I suppose you could say hey he was better than he had been lately the bar has been low he has not been pitching well as we have chronicled but even in a game in which he was doing well for a while he ends up giving up five runs and five and 2/3 Innings and so you have to say it's another disappointing outing for McKenzie Gore we've talked way to Abrams hit in the air to left easy play for Wilson coming in makes the catch shallow left and the game is over one pitch later so I mentioned that there was Major Bullpen news for the Nats on Saturday there was the Nats on Saturday afternoon announced a FLIR of roster moves regarding the bullpen principle among those moves the Nats putting reliever Derek law on the 15-day injured list due to a right elbow flexor strain that is not a phrase that you like to hear with any pitcher right right elbow flexor strain because that can be a precursor to needing Tommy John surgery now the good news is that law does not seem to think that this is serious although what is often the case is that pitchers will tell you that an injury is not serious even if the injury might be serious but it sounds like this in fact may not be serious so hopefully that is in fact the case but this was not something that we were anticipating heck Derek law pitched on Friday evening he tossed a scoreless and hitless bottom of the eighth but it turns out that he was actually supposed to come out to pitch in the ninth but decided that discretion was the better part of all because he was not feeling entirely great and now he's on the 15-day iil with his right elbow flexor strain and that absolutely is a blow to this Bullpen we've talked about law struggles when it comes to inherited Runners this season but Derek LOF of this regular season as of games through Friday was number two among all Nats relievers in wins above replacement wor for baseball reference at 1.5 Dylan floro was number one at 1.6 LW was was number two at 1.5 he overall has done a good job for this team has eaten up a ton of innings has pitched in a ton of games you have to wonder if the workload is catching up to that
